The Facts:
The Eagles are working on a new deal with Donovan McNabb. A league source has told CSN’s Derrick Gunn that the two sides have been discussing an extension for the past month.
Reported by Comcast SportsNet
Fantasy Football Diehards Line:
According to the report, the two sides have agreed to pause negotiating an extension until a later date and instead decided to focus on reworking the two years remaining on his current deal. McNabb is scheduled to earn $9.2 million this season and $10 million in 2010. The veteran signal caller has made no secret of his desire for an extension that would put to rest rest the annual discussion of whether he'll remain an Eagle or not.
